1. London Business School
When it comes to Business education, London Business School (LBS) is a name that stands out. Established in 1964, LBS has consistently ranked amongst the Top Business Schools globally. With a diverse student body hailing from over 130 countries, LBS offers a truly international learning experience. The school offers a range of programs, including an MBA, Executive MBA, and various Masters in Management programs. LBS prides itself on its faculty, which consists of world-renowned academics and industry experts. With its prime location in the heart of London, LBS provides its students with unparalleled networking opportunities and access to global businesses.
2. Imperial College Business School
Imperial College Business School, a part of Imperial College London, is known for its focus on innovation and entrepreneurship. The school offers a range of programs, including a full-time MBA, Executive MBA, and specialized Masters degrees in areas such as Finance, Entrepreneurship, and Innovation. Imperial College Business School places a strong emphasis on experiential learning, providing its students with real-world Business challenges and opportunities to work with industry partners. With its close ties to the wider Imperial College London community, the Business school benefits from collaborations with renowned scientists and engineers, fostering a unique interdisciplinary approach to Business education.

2. How do I apply to Business Schools in London?
Applying to Business Schools in London requires careful preparation and attention to detail. Here are the general steps involved in the application process:
1. Research: Begin by researching the Business Schools in London and their specific admission requirements. Look for information on application deadlines, required documents, and any additional criteria.
2. Prepare your application materials: Gather all the necessary documents, which typically include academic transcripts, letters of recommendation, a personal statement, and a resume or CV. Make sure to tailor your application materials to each school’s specific requirements.
3. Take standardized tests: Most Business Schools in London require applicants to submit scores from standardized tests such as the GMAT or GRE. Prepare for these tests well in advance and schedule your test dates accordingly.
4. Submit your application: Once you have completed all the necessary steps, submit your application online through the school’s official website. Pay attention to any application fees and ensure that you meet the specified deadlines.

3. What is the cost of studying at Business Schools in London?
The cost of studying at Business Schools in London can vary depending on the specific program and institution. Here are some factors to consider when calculating the cost:
1. Tuition fees: Tuition fees for Business Schools in London can range from around £20,000 to over £90,000 per year, depending on the program and school. It is important to check the official websites of the Schools for the most accurate and up-to-date information.
2. Living expenses: London is known for its high living costs. Students should consider accommodation, transportation, meals, and other daily expenses when calculating the overall cost of studying in the city.
3. Scholarships and financial aid: Many Business Schools in London offer scholarships and financial aid options to help students offset the cost of tuition. It is advisable to research and apply for these opportunities well in advance.
